Im thinking about getting me some rudder pedals but they are insanely expensive, starting @ $98 bucks because only CH products makes them (don't kow what happened to thrustmaster) .

So im thinking of getting some old one off ebay but there are a lot of gameport Peddals for a lot less then the USB ones.
Is there a reason for that?
Are Gameport Peddals any good?
Any type of compatibility issues or anything that would cause them to be sold at such a low price?
I have a gameport but do they work with windows Xp?

Game port pedals have some limitations...and have fewer functions.

The newer USB pedals can be had with toe brakes (like a real plane) in addition to the rudder function.

GP pedals are harder on system resources, they require more frequent calibration, they may not work with all USB sticks and they may not be able to be assigned in all games as a second controller (USB pedals share this in poorly designed games).

My current, quite functional, GP pedals are on the way out as soon as I do my next comp upgrade in the next few months...USB pedals for me. :)

My GP pedals have worked fine, with a GP stick, in all sims where I've tried them...including the two you mention.

They no longer work with my Saitek X45 USB HOTAS (I could tweak the drivers to make them work though)...but the new pedals go on just as soon as the new comp is finished. :)
